Find specialists in Rumford, Scotland

The most extensive list of specialists in Rumford, Scotland













Types of specialists in Rumford, Scotland

Weather in Rumford, Scotland

08.05.2024 14 — 16
09.05.2024 11 — 18
10.05.2024 10 — 20